精准掌握2025年计算机四级数据库考试的试题及答案_第1页
精准掌握2025年计算机四级数据库考试的试题及答案_第2页
精准掌握2025年计算机四级数据库考试的试题及答案_第3页
精准掌握2025年计算机四级数据库考试的试题及答案_第4页
精准掌握2025年计算机四级数据库考试的试题及答案_第5页
已阅读5页,还剩4页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

精准掌握2025年计算机四级数据库考试的试题及答案姓名:____________________

一、单项选择题(每题2分,共10题)

1.在关系数据库中,实体之间的关系通常表示为:

A.函数依赖

B.外键

C.索引

D.视图

2.以下哪个命令用于在SQLServer中创建一个新的数据库?

A.CREATETABLE

B.CREATEINDEX

C.CREATEDATABASE

D.CREATEVIEW

3.在数据库设计中,数据完整性指的是:

A.数据的准确性

B.数据的独立性

C.数据的完整性

D.数据的可靠性

4.下列哪个SQL语句用于删除数据库中的数据?

A.INSERTINTO

B.DELETEFROM

C.UPDATE

D.SELECT

5.以下哪种数据类型在数据库中用于存储货币值?

A.VARCHAR

B.INT

C.DECIMAL

D.DATE

6.在SQL查询中,使用DISTINCT关键字的作用是:

A.去除重复的行

B.按照指定顺序排序

C.选择特定的列

D.使用通配符匹配

7.在数据库设计中,主键用于:

A.确定数据行的唯一性

B.提高查询效率

C.存储数据内容

D.实现数据的关联

8.以下哪个数据库管理系统是开源的?

A.Oracle

B.MySQL

C.SQLServer

D.PostgreSQL

9.在SQL查询中,使用JOIN操作可以实现:

A.连接两个或多个表

B.查询特定列

C.排序数据

D.过滤数据

10.以下哪个命令用于在SQLServer中修改表结构?

A.CREATETABLE

B.ALTERTABLE

C.DROPTABLE

D.SELECT

答案:1.B2.C3.C4.B5.C6.A7.A8.B9.A10.B

二、多项选择题(每题3分,共10题)

1.以下哪些是数据库设计中的范式?

A.第一范式(1NF)

B.第二范式(2NF)

C.第三范式(3NF)

D.第四范式(4NF)

E.第五范式(5NF)

2.在SQL查询中,可以使用以下哪些运算符进行条件判断?

A.=

B.>

C.<>

D.>=

E.<=

3.以下哪些是数据库事务的特性?

A.原子性(Atomicity)

B.一致性(Consistency)

C.隔离性(Isolation)

D.持久性(Durability)

E.可逆性(Reversibility)

4.在数据库中,以下哪些是常见的索引类型?

A.单一索引

B.组合索引

C.全文索引

D.哈希索引

E.聚集索引

5.以下哪些是SQL查询中的聚合函数?

A.SUM()

B.AVG()

C.MIN()

D.MAX()

E.COUNT()

6.在数据库设计中,以下哪些是数据模型?

A.层次模型

B.网状模型

C.关系模型

D.物化视图

E.概念模型

7.以下哪些是数据库备份的方法?

A.完全备份

B.差异备份

C.增量备份

D.热备份

E.冷备份

8.在SQL查询中,可以使用以下哪些关键字进行分组?

A.GROUPBY

B.HAVING

C.ORDERBY

D.WHERE

E.DISTINCT

9.以下哪些是数据库安全性的措施?

A.用户认证

B.访问控制

C.数据加密

D.数据备份

E.数据恢复

10.在数据库设计中,以下哪些是数据一致性的保证?

A.实体完整性

B.域完整性

C.参照完整性

D.用户权限

E.事务完整性

三、判断题(每题2分,共10题)

1.在关系数据库中,所有列都应该是非空的,以满足数据的完整性。(×)

2.数据库管理系统(DBMS)负责存储、检索和管理数据。(√)

3.第三范式(3NF)确保所有非主属性对主键都是完全函数依赖的。(√)

4.使用索引可以显著提高查询效率,但过多的索引会降低更新速度。(√)

5.事务的隔离性要求当一个事务正在执行时,其他事务必须等待,直到第一个事务完成。(×)

6.数据库中的外键可以用于确保数据的一致性。(√)

7.在数据库设计中,所有实体都应该是第一范式(1NF)的。(×)

8.使用JOIN操作可以在查询中结合来自不同表的数据。(√)

9.数据库备份是数据库管理的一个重要组成部分,可以防止数据丢失。(√)

10.数据库安全包括对数据库进行物理保护以及控制用户访问权限。(√)

四、简答题(每题5分,共6题)

1.简述数据库设计中的ER模型,并说明其主要组成部分。

2.解释SQL查询中的JOIN操作,并列举三种常见的JOIN类型及其区别。

3.描述数据库事务的四个特性(ACID),并解释每个特性的含义。

4.说明数据库备份的重要性,并列出至少三种常见的数据库备份方法。

5.简述数据库安全性的主要方面,并解释如何通过这些方面来保护数据库。

6.解释什么是数据库规范化,并说明其目的和主要优点。

试卷答案如下

一、单项选择题

1.B在关系数据库中,实体之间的关系通常通过外键来表示。

2.CCREATEDATABASE命令用于创建一个新的数据库。

3.C数据完整性指的是数据的准确性、完整性和一致性。

4.BDELETEFROM命令用于删除数据库中的数据。

5.CDECIMAL数据类型用于存储精确的小数值,如货币。

6.ADISTINCT关键字用于去除查询结果中的重复行。

7.A主键用于确定数据行的唯一性,是数据库设计的基础。

8.BMySQL是一个开源的关系数据库管理系统。

9.AJOIN操作用于连接两个或多个表,以获取相关联的数据。

10.BALTERTABLE命令用于修改表结构。

二、多项选择题

1.A,B,C,D,E第一范式至第五范式是数据库设计中常用的范式。

2.A,B,C,D,E在SQL查询中,可以使用这些运算符进行条件判断。

3.A,B,C,D,E数据库事务的ACID特性确保事务的可靠性。

4.A,B,C,D,E这些是数据库中常见的索引类型,各有其适用场景。

5.A,B,C,D,E聚合函数用于对一组值进行计算,如求和、平均值等。

6.A,B,C,E层次模型、网状模型、关系模型和概念模型是常见的数据模型。

7.A,B,C,D,E数据库备份的方法包括完全备份、差异备份、增量备份和热备份。

8.A,B,C,D,EGROUPBY和HAVING关键字用于对查询结果进行分组。

9.A,B,C,D,E数据库安全性包括用户认证、访问控制、数据加密和数据恢复。

10.A,B,C,D,E实体完整性、域完整性、参照完整性和事务完整性是数据一致性的保证。

三、判断题

1.×所有列不一定是非空的,但主键列通常是不可为空的。

2.√DBMS负责管理数据的存储、检索和操作。

3.√第三范式确保所有非主属性都直接依赖于主键。

4.√索引可以加快查询速度,但过多索引会增加更新操作的成本。

5.×事务的隔离性要求并发事务之间不会互相干扰,但不一定要求等待。

6.√外键确保了数据的一致性和引用完整性。

7.×不是所有实体都必须是第一范式,第二范式及以上范式更为重要。

8.√JOIN操作可以将两个或多个表中的数据结合起来。

9.√数据库备份可以防止数据丢失,确保数据恢复。

10.√数据库安全性包括多个方面,如用户权限、物理安全等。

四、简答题

1.ER模型是一种用于数据库设计的概念模型,由实体、属性和关系组成。实体代表表中的数据记录,属性代表实体的特征,关系描述实体之间的联系。

2.JOIN操作用于结合两个或多个表的数据。常见的JOIN类型包括INNERJOIN(内连接)、LEFTJOIN(左连接)和RIGHTJOIN(右连接)。它们的主要区别在于返回的记录数和连接条件。

3.数据库事务的ACID特性包括:原子性(确保事务作为一个整体被执行或完全不做)、一致性(确保事务执行后数据库的状态保持一致)、隔离性(确保并发事务之间不会相互干扰)和持久性(确保已提交的事务对数据库的更改是永久性的)。

4.数据库备份的重要性在于防止数据丢失,确保在数据损坏或丢失时可以恢复数据。常见的备份方法包括完全备份、差异

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论